Index of /images/imgPosts

 NameLast modifiedSizeDescription

 Parent Directory   -  
 175985836758695961.jpg 2025-10-07 12:32 151K 
 175944380823941676.jpg 2025-10-02 17:23 149K 
 175944378697362260.jpg 2025-10-02 17:23 149K 
 175944335612471890.jpg 2025-10-02 17:15 109K